packaging is much more than just a way to contain and protect a product; it is often the first interaction that a customer has with a brand. The packaging of a product serves as a visual representation of what is inside, conveying important information about the product and the company behind it. In today’s competitive market, packaging plays a crucial role in influencing consumer purchasing decisions and can make or break a product’s success.
The design of a product’s packaging is a vital aspect of the branding process. A well-designed package can help a product stand out on the shelves and catch the eye of potential customers. packaging design encompasses the visual elements of a product’s package, including colors, fonts, imagery, and overall layout. These elements work together to create a cohesive look that communicates the brand’s identity and values.
packaging also serves a practical purpose by protecting the product during transportation and storage. It must be durable enough to withstand handling and shipping without damaging the product inside. Additionally, packaging must be functional and convenient for consumers to use, with features like easy-open seals and resealable closures.
In recent years, there has been a growing emphasis on sustainable packaging solutions as consumers become more environmentally conscious. Sustainable packaging aims to minimize the environmental impact of packaging materials by using recyclable, biodegradable, or compostable materials. Brands that prioritize sustainability in their packaging not only appeal to eco-conscious consumers but also contribute to reducing waste and conserving natural resources.
In addition to protecting the product and communicating the brand’s identity, packaging plays a crucial role in marketing and promotion. Packaging design can influence consumer perception of a product and affect their purchase decisions. Eye-catching packaging can create a sense of excitement and curiosity, prompting consumers to pick up the product and learn more about it.
Packaging also serves as a powerful marketing tool by providing valuable real estate for brand messaging and product information. The packaging can showcase key features and benefits of the product, highlight special promotions or discounts, and communicate the brand’s values and story. Effective packaging design can help create a memorable brand experience and foster brand loyalty among consumers.
Furthermore, packaging can play a strategic role in differentiating a product from its competitors. In a crowded marketplace, brands must find ways to stand out and attract consumers’ attention. Unique and innovative packaging designs can help a product carve out a distinct identity and position itself as a premium or luxury option.
The rise of e-commerce has also transformed the role of packaging in the retail industry. Online shopping has become increasingly popular, with more consumers opting to make purchases online rather than in physical stores. As a result, packaging has become an essential touchpoint for online brands to connect with customers and create a positive unboxing experience.
Effective packaging design for e-commerce must be not only attractive and informative but also protective and efficient for shipping. Brands must consider the impact of packaging on the overall customer experience, from the moment the package arrives on their doorstep to the moment they open it and interact with the product inside.
